7. Superintendent’s Agenda:

7a. Superintendent's Update:

The Superintendent will present to the school committee on various matters pertaining to the opening of the 2026 - 2027 school year, including follow up reports on items discussed by the Cambridge School Committee during the second half of the 2025 - 2026 school year. These brief updates will include: 

  1. Secondary math instruction, including Algebra course offerings to 8th and 9th grade students 
  2. Developing guidance around appropriate use of technology and monitoring of screen time by students 
  3. Specific efforts to prioritize literacy instruction across elementary grade levels 
  4. Upcoming public engagement and deliberations over the future use of 158 Spring Street 
7b. Presentations:

The Superintendent and Chief Academic Officer will be joined by representatives of Attuned Education Partners LLC who will provide an update on the ongoing development of the long-term strategic plan for the Cambridge Public Schools.
